Hi dalebru, thanks fro your ninjascripts. I'm trying to convert .ntd tick file to json .

can you help me how to get tick data from your BruReadNtd script? The BruReadNtd.ReadAndCacheNtd return only a bool ...

exscuse my incompetence...

Thanks for your help

I'm not sure I understand. You might take a look at ReadFile(), which returns a list of bars:
private static List<BruBar> ReadFile(DataType dataType, string filename)
If you use DataType.Tick, each "bar" in the list will represent a tick.
